Skip to content
体验新版
项目
组织
正在加载...
登录
切换导航
打开侧边栏
openanolis
cloud-kernel
提交
91bf9a25
cloud-kernel
项目概览
openanolis
/
cloud-kernel
大约 1 年 前同步成功
通知
158
Star
36
Fork
7
代码
文件
提交
分支
Tags
贡献者
分支图
Diff
Issue
10
列表
看板
标记
里程碑
合并请求
2
Wiki
0
Wiki
分析
仓库
DevOps
项目成员
Pages
cloud-kernel
项目概览
项目概览
详情
发布
仓库
仓库
文件
提交
分支
标签
贡献者
分支图
比较
Issue
10
Issue
10
列表
看板
标记
里程碑
合并请求
2
合并请求
2
Pages
分析
分析
仓库分析
DevOps
Wiki
0
Wiki
成员
成员
收起侧边栏
关闭侧边栏
动态
分支图
创建新Issue
提交
Issue看板
提交
91bf9a25
编写于
6月 23, 2009
作者:
S
Sascha Hauer
浏览文件
操作
浏览文件
下载
电子邮件补丁
差异文件
pcm037: Add support for SJA1000 on baseboard
Signed-off-by:
N
Sascha Hauer
<
s.hauer@pengutronix.de
>
上级
343684ff
变更
1
隐藏空白更改
内联
并排
Showing
1 changed file
with
30 addition
and
0 deletion
+30
-0
arch/arm/mach-mx3/pcm037.c
arch/arm/mach-mx3/pcm037.c
+30
-0
未找到文件。
arch/arm/mach-mx3/pcm037.c
浏览文件 @
91bf9a25
...
...
@@ -32,6 +32,7 @@
#include <linux/spi/spi.h>
#include <linux/irq.h>
#include <linux/fsl_devices.h>
#include <linux/can/platform/sja1000.h>
#include <media/soc_camera.h>
...
...
@@ -514,6 +515,33 @@ static struct mx3fb_platform_data mx3fb_pdata = {
.
num_modes
=
ARRAY_SIZE
(
fb_modedb
),
};
static
struct
resource
pcm970_sja1000_resources
[]
=
{
{
.
start
=
CS5_BASE_ADDR
,
.
end
=
CS5_BASE_ADDR
+
0x100
-
1
,
.
flags
=
IORESOURCE_MEM
,
},
{
.
start
=
IOMUX_TO_IRQ
(
IOMUX_PIN
(
48
,
105
)),
.
end
=
IOMUX_TO_IRQ
(
IOMUX_PIN
(
48
,
105
)),
.
flags
=
IORESOURCE_IRQ
|
IORESOURCE_IRQ_LOWEDGE
,
},
};
struct
sja1000_platform_data
pcm970_sja1000_platform_data
=
{
.
clock
=
16000000
/
2
,
.
ocr
=
0x40
|
0x18
,
.
cdr
=
0x40
,
};
static
struct
platform_device
pcm970_sja1000
=
{
.
name
=
"sja1000_platform"
,
.
dev
=
{
.
platform_data
=
&
pcm970_sja1000_platform_data
,
},
.
resource
=
pcm970_sja1000_resources
,
.
num_resources
=
ARRAY_SIZE
(
pcm970_sja1000_resources
),
};
/*
* Board specific initialization.
*/
...
...
@@ -574,6 +602,8 @@ static void __init mxc_board_init(void)
if
(
!
pcm037_camera_alloc_dma
(
4
*
1024
*
1024
))
mxc_register_device
(
&
mx3_camera
,
&
camera_pdata
);
platform_device_register
(
&
pcm970_sja1000
);
}
static
void
__init
pcm037_timer_init
(
void
)
...
...
编辑
预览
Markdown
is supported
0%
请重试
或
添加新附件
.
添加附件
取消
You are about to add
0
people
to the discussion. Proceed with caution.
先完成此消息的编辑!
取消
想要评论请
注册
或
登录